机器人编程offs是什么
-
机器人编程中的"offs"是"offset"的缩写,表示偏移量或偏移值。在机器人编程中,偏移量是指一个物体或目标相对于机器人基准位置的位置差异。通过计算偏移量,可以使机器人能够准确地定位和操作目标。
偏移量通常以三个值表示,分别是X轴偏移、Y轴偏移和Z轴偏移。X轴偏移表示目标在机器人坐标系中的水平方向上的位置差异,Y轴偏移表示目标在垂直方向上的位置差异,Z轴偏移表示目标在深度方向上的位置差异。
在机器人编程中,通过计算目标与机器人基准位置之间的偏移量,可以确定机器人需要移动的距离和方向。这样,机器人就能够根据偏移量的信息准确地控制自己的运动,以完成特定的任务,如抓取、放置、装配等。
通过设定适当的偏移量,机器人可以根据不同的工作场景和需求进行精确定位和操作。偏移量的计算可以通过机器人编程语言或机器人控制系统来实现。不同的机器人品牌和型号可能会有不同的编程方式和语法,但基本的偏移量概念是通用的。
总之,偏移量在机器人编程中扮演着重要的角色,能够帮助机器人实现准确的定位和操作,提高工作效率和精度。
1年前 -
机器人编程中的offs是一种常见的编程语言或编程平台,用于控制和编程机器人的行为和动作。下面是关于offs的五个要点:
-
offs(Open Firmware For Robots)是一种开源机器人编程语言和平台。它基于C语言和C++开发,并使用面向对象的编程方法。offs提供了一套丰富的库和工具,使机器人编程变得更加简单和高效。
-
offs的设计目标是提供一个通用的机器人编程框架,使机器人能够执行各种任务和动作。它支持机器人的感知、决策和控制功能,可以用于编写机器人的导航、运动控制、视觉处理等任务。
-
offs采用了模块化的设计,可以轻松地扩展和定制机器人的功能。它提供了丰富的模块和接口,可以与各种传感器、执行器和硬件设备进行集成。同时,offs还支持多线程编程,可以同时处理多个任务和传感器数据。
-
offs提供了一个直观的图形化编程界面,使初学者能够快速上手。它使用了流程图和拖拽式编程的方式,用户只需将不同的模块和功能拖拽到编程界面上,并连接它们,即可完成机器人的编程。这种可视化编程方式使机器人编程变得更加简单和直观。
-
offs是一个开放的平台,拥有活跃的社区和开发者群体。用户可以在官方网站上下载和使用offs,还可以参与社区讨论、分享经验和获取技术支持。这个开放的生态系统为机器人编程提供了更多的资源和支持,使offs成为了一个受欢迎的机器人编程平台。
总而言之,offs是一种开源的机器人编程语言和平台,通过提供丰富的库和工具,支持模块化的设计和可视化的编程方式,使机器人编程变得更加简单和高效。它的开放性和活跃的社区为机器人编程提供了更多的资源和支持。
1年前 -
-
机器人编程中的"offs"是一种常用的术语,它是"offset"的缩写,意为偏移量。在机器人编程中,偏移量指的是一个数值,用于指定机器人执行动作时的位置或方向相对于参考点的偏移量。
偏移量可以用于控制机器人的位置、姿态、速度等参数。它可以是三维空间中的坐标值,也可以是机器人的关节角度。通过调整偏移量,可以实现机器人在工作空间内的精确定位和运动控制。
下面将从方法、操作流程等方面详细讲解机器人编程中的偏移量的使用。
一、使用偏移量的方法
-
基于坐标系统的偏移量:机器人编程中常用的一种方法是基于坐标系统的偏移量。这种方法适用于需要机器人在三维空间中进行定位和运动控制的场景。通过定义一个参考点,将机器人的位置和方向相对于该参考点进行描述。偏移量可以通过坐标系的转换来实现。常见的坐标系统包括笛卡尔坐标系、极坐标系和欧拉角坐标系等。
-
基于关节角度的偏移量:对于具有多个关节的机器人,可以使用关节角度来描述机器人的姿态。通过调整关节角度的偏移量,可以实现机器人在关节空间内的精确控制。这种方法适用于需要机器人进行复杂运动或特定动作的场景。
二、使用偏移量的操作流程
在机器人编程中,使用偏移量通常需要经过以下步骤:
-
定义参考点:确定机器人的参考点,即机器人执行动作的基准点。
-
设定偏移量:根据实际需求,设定机器人的偏移量。可以通过手动输入数值、从外部传感器获取数据或使用算法计算得出。
-
坐标系转换:如果使用基于坐标系统的偏移量,需要进行坐标系的转换。将参考点与机器人的基准点进行对应,确定机器人的位置和方向。
-
控制机器人运动:根据偏移量的设定,控制机器人执行相应的动作。可以通过编程语言或机器人控制软件实现。
-
检查和调整:执行完动作后,检查机器人的位置和姿态是否与预期一致。如果需要调整,可以重新设定偏移量或进行校准。
三、示例应用场景
-
机器人装配:在装配过程中,机器人需要精确定位和控制动作。通过设定偏移量,可以使机器人准确地插入零部件或对其进行拧紧。
-
机器人焊接:在焊接过程中,机器人需要根据焊接路径进行精确控制。通过设定偏移量,可以调整机器人的位置和姿态,确保焊接点的准确性。
-
机器人物料搬运:在物料搬运过程中,机器人需要根据不同的物料尺寸和位置进行抓取和放置。通过设定偏移量,可以调整机器人的抓取位置和姿态,确保物料的准确搬运。
总结:在机器人编程中,偏移量是一种常用的术语,用于描述机器人执行动作时的位置或方向的偏移量。使用偏移量可以实现机器人在工作空间内的精确定位和运动控制。通过定义参考点、设定偏移量、坐标系转换和控制机器人运动等步骤,可以有效地使用偏移量。在实际应用中,偏移量广泛应用于机器人装配、焊接、物料搬运等场景中。
1年前 -